Data Protection 
Write-Protection of the Data Cartridge While Inside the Drive 
The Write-Protect switch on the data cartridge can be moved while the 
cartridge is loaded into the drive. The drive will turn on the Write Protected 
LED immediately. However, if the drive is writing to the cartridge, write 
protect does not take effect until the write operation is completed. 
  If you move the Write-Protect switch from the write-protected position 
(to the right) to the write-enabled position (to the left), the cartridge 
becomes write-enabled immediately. 
  If you move the Write-Protect switch from the write-enabled position 
(on the left) to the write-protected position (to the right), the cartridge 
becomes write-protected immediately. 
Write-Protection of the Data Cartridge Outside of the Drive 
Move the Write-Protect switch to the right to write-protect the cartridge. 
Data cannot be written to, or erased from the cartridge. 
Move the Write-Protect switch to the left to make the cartridge write-
enabled. Data can now be written to, or erased from the cartridge, assuming it 
is not already software write-protected. 
Removing the Data Cartridge 
To unload a cartridge from the drive, perform the following steps: 
❐  Push the Unload button. 
The front panel indicators will display the following: 
Indicator  State, Character, or Message 
Status LED 
Green, flashing 
Single-character display  Off 
LCD 
Cartridge Unloading 
In Progress 
❐  When the cartridge is ejected from the drive, remove the cartridge. 
Caution 
After the cartridge is removed from the drive, return it to its plastic case to 
prolong the cartridge life.
